CHOCOLATE PEANUT BUTTER THUMBPRINTS

The popular combination of chocolate and peanut butter is hard to beat...and the cream filling in these cookies takes them beyond the ordinary!-Nancy Foust, Stoneboro, Pennsylvania

Time 50m

Yield about 3 dozen.

Number Of Ingredients 15

1 cup butter-flavored shortening
1 cup sugar
2 egg yolks
2 tablespoons milk
2 ounces unsweetened chocolate, melted and cooled
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
2 cups all-purpose flour
1/2 teaspoon salt
2/3 cup miniature semisweet chocolate chips
FILLING:
1/3 cup creamy peanut butter
2 tablespoons butter-flavored shortening
1 cup plus 2 tablespoons confectioners' sugar
2 tablespoons milk
1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, cream shortening and sugar. Beat in the egg yolks, milk, melted chocolate and vanilla. Combine flour and salt; gradually add to chocolate mixture. Stir in chocolate chips. Roll into 1-in. balls., Place 2 in. apart on greased baking sheets. Using the end of a wooden spoon handle, make an indentation in the center of each ball. Bake at 350° for 11-13 minutes or until firm. Remove to wire racks to cool completely., Meanwhile, for filling, in a small bowl, beat peanut butter and shortening until combined. Beat in the confectioners' sugar, milk and vanilla until smooth. Fill cookies with filling. Store in an airtight container.
